Description
Stoneware Copper Ware jug with two beakers, with simulated copper rivets, all with sterling silver mounted rim, design & execution by Doulton Lambeth Silicon 1893 / England
Copper
Ware was introduced in the late 1800's by Doulton Lambeth Silicon, reflecting the Arts and Crafts influence of the era
